Default Email app from CM9 [ Neo / Neo V ]

Ummm..first of all, this is my first ever thread. Second,I HOPE THIS IS NOT A MIRROR OF ANY THREAD (cos I made a search,couldnt find anything similar)

So..I was very impressed with the email app on CM9 (gold-coloured one) .. it was really faster and better than the stock email app on ICS 4.0.4 .
so,I tried porting it..from CM9rc2 to Stock 4.0.4
and voila! it works!

I ve attached links below..

All u need to do is :
1. download,unzip
2. copy to /system ( via root explorer)
3. change permissions to RWRR
4. move it to /system/app and replace the originals
5. reboot and enjoy!

I would recommend you to make a backup of the originals.
